How they compare
Finland currently reports 1.05 against 0.91 in Ireland, a difference of 0.14.
That makes Finland's figure about 1.2 times Ireland's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 15 shared years of data; in 2010 it was Ireland ahead.
Finland ranks 26th and Ireland ranks 29th of 126 countries.
Across the 2 decades both report, Finland averaged higher in 1 and Ireland in 1.
